- The official HD remaster of The Specials performing 'Do Nothing', recorded live on BBC Top Of The Pops 18th December 1980. This video was remastered in HD.

I love how Terry's performance captures the song, the lazy swaying along, the gum chewing, the look of apathy on his face. It's like him having an existential crisis in the middle of everyone pretending like everything is good and okay around him, and his little look to the sky at the end is just everything.
